Some people in Tien Lang town, Tien Lang district, Hai Phong city, reflected that recently, many shops in the area in front of the stadium gate in Tien Lang district have put up signs, selling goods, encroaching on the sidewalk. . Many people expressed questions and concerns about whether or not these business households arbitrarily "parachuted" to encroach and set up sales kiosks?
According to people's feedback, we were present at the stadium area of Tien Lang district at noon on April 17. At the main gate of the stadium, along the central route of Tien Lang town, there are about 4 kiosks mainly selling coffee, soft drinks, and breakfast items. Some kiosks display signs, tables and chairs encroaching on the sidewalk. In the side gate area of Tien Lang district stadium, there are 20 food service kiosks and a Billard Club.
At the meeting with Reporter about feedback from local people, Mr. Pham Xuan Hoa - Chief of Office of the People's Committee of Tien Lang District, Hai Phong City, affirmed that there is no such thing as business households arbitrarily "parachuting" to encroach and set up sales kiosks.

Mr. Luong Van Thang - Director of the Center for Culture, Information and Sports of Tien Lang District, Hai Phong City, admitted that recently there have been some kiosk owners at the main gate of the stadium displaying tables, chairs and signs encroaching on the sidewalk. .
Faced with this situation, in the coming time, the District Center for Culture, Information and Sports will coordinate with relevant authorities of the district and Tien Lang town government to organize forces to regularly inspect, remind and handle the situation. strictly punish violations according to regulations.
